While the doctrine of stare decisis encourages consistency, there are instances when courts may well decide to overturn existing precedents. Higher courts, like supreme courts, have the authority to re-Examine previous decisions, particularly when societal values or legal interpretations evolve. Overturning a precedent generally takes place when a past decision is considered outdated, unjust, or incompatible with new legal principles.

Case law would be the body of legislation formulated from judicial opinions or decisions over time (whereas statutory law arrives from legislative bodies and administrative legislation will come from executive bodies).

Inside a legal setting, stare decisis refers back to the principle that decisions made by higher courts are binding on reduced courts, selling fairness and balance throughout common regulation as well as legal system.
